Harbhajan Singh Praises Teenage Cricketer Vaibhav Sooryavanshi’s Remarkable Talent

Former India spinner Harbhajan Singh has lauded 15-year-old batsman Vaibhav Sooryavanshi as an extraordinary talent, commending his fearless approach to the game. Singh expressed admiration for Sooryavanshi’s unique abilities, highlighting the youngster’s bold style of play that sets him apart in modern cricket. The cricketer emphasized the evolving landscape of the sport, where players are encouraged to showcase their natural instincts rather than conforming to traditional norms.

Singh attributed the shift in mindset within Indian cricket to the growing acceptance of players who exhibit a fearless attitude and play with freedom. He noted the impact of media and social platforms in amplifying the achievements of young cricketers like Sooryavanshi, underscoring the unprecedented nature of his talent. Singh recounted a memorable incident from Sooryavanshi’s Indian Premier League debut, where the young player’s confidence and aggressive approach left a lasting impression.

Despite facing initial challenges in his international career, Sooryavanshi made history by becoming India’s youngest international cricketer during the T20I series against England. While the teenager encountered difficulties with the bat in the series, he remains a promising prospect for the national team. Sooryavanshi’s inclusion in India’s squad for the upcoming T20I series against Zimbabwe reflects the selectors’ confidence in his abilities and potential to make significant contributions to the team.
